Bulldog netters down Wapak
By Cort Reynolds
ADA - The Ada tennis team defeated Western Buckeye League foe Wapakoneta 4-1 at the Ohio Northern University Marmon Courts Thursday evening.
The Bulldog netters improved to 4-1 with their third win over a WBL squad this season. Wapak fell to 4-2 with the loss.
"I was very pleased with today's outcome," said Ada head coach Cody Hurley. "We played our most complete match from top to bottom as a team this season, and we picked up a great win as a result.
"Cade and Miranda were very impressive in singles, winning in straights sets. Isaac battled to the end and finished strong after 2.5 hours sweeping singles for us.
"We tried some new doubles tactics today and it worked for both the first and second doubles teams. All of the hard work we have put into doubles is finally paying off," he added.
Mullins and Spar each improved to 4-0 this season with their singles wins. Wills upped her record to 4-1 with a straight-sets win after a tough first set at third singles.
Gabe Hasan and Dexter Woods earned the second doubles win.
Ada 4, Wapakoneta 1
Singles results:
1. Cade Mullins (A) def. Curtis Hughes (W) 6-0, 6-0
2. Isaac Spar (A) def. John Doll (W) 4-6, 6-3, 6-4
3. Miranda Wills (A) def. Austin Hancock (W) 7-5, 6-0
Doubles:
1D. Noah Kirby/Jesse Mackenzie (W) def. Reece Evans/Morgan Swick (A) 6-1, 2-6, 6-1
2D. Gabe Hasan/Dexter Woods (A) def. Alvaro Guerrero/Logan Shirk (W) 6-1, 6-1
Ada is slated to play at Van Wert Friday and at state power Lexington Saturday.
